A series of basic domain patterns are extracted from the MFM images. Some of them seem unique to 2-D materials as they are not observed in 3-D materials, such as self-fitting disks, and fine ladder structure within Y-connected walls. Based on these findings, a phase map is drawn for the magnetic phase structures.
